Role of Humanitarian Cardiac Surgery Missions in Developing the Next Generation of Global Surgeons

2022 
With a lack of comprehensive health care systems in resource constrained countries, Global Cardiac Surgery plays a vital role in bridging the gap in access to surgical care. Global Cardiac Surgery relies primarily on voluntary humanitarian multidisciplinary teams whose make up vary but often include medical students. The inclusion of medical students on humanitarian missions has been called into question because of the perceived limited sociocultural competence, risks to patient safety, ethical concerns, diverting focus to medical education over patient care, and financial burden. However, there is growing evidence that for appropriately selected medical students, surgical mission trips can serve as a professional investment by providing them knowledge in global health and surgery and help foster a future career in Global Cardiac Surgery. In order to help develop the next generation of global surgeons, medical students should be adequately trained and encouraged to participate in Global Cardiac Surgery while ensuring their education does not come at a cost to the local population or patient safety.
